Test Management in Software Testing
About this Course
This course on Test Management will provide learners with the essential skills to effectively plan, execute, and assess testing processes in software development. It caters to both beginners looking to grasp foundational concepts and intermediate professionals aiming to refine their testing management skills. Through practical examples and interactive exercises, participants will learn key test management principles, tools, and best practices that enhance software quality. This course is ideal for software testers, QA engineers, project managers, and team leaders who want to improve their understanding and skills in managing testing processes. A basic understanding of the software development life cycle (SDLC) and familiarity with software testing concepts will be helpful for this course. By the end of this course, learners will be equipped to implement effective test management strategies that contribute significantly to project success.Created by: Coursera Instructor Network
